Transaction e86ce2302603500dc407db25321f531e6522e9ecb416555e098adf45f88761dc
1 Input
1 Output
-
e86ce2302603500dc407db25321f531e6522e9ecb416555e098adf45f88761dc:0
- value
- 4767494
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 35cad61f79fdb3299f65a252c9eace31029f40e1e1fff95c4a4a66401bef059a
- address
- bc1pxh9dv8melkejn8m95ffvn6kwxypf7s8pu8lljhz2ffnyqxl0qkdqjlpd43